Artistic History of Montmartre

Montmartre, renowned for its artistic history, has long been a hub for creative minds and a source of inspiration for artists from around the world. This vibrant neighborhood in Paris has attracted painters, writers, poets, and musicians throughout the years, making it a melting pot of artistic expression.

In the late 19th and early 20th centuries, Montmartre was the epicenter of the bohemian movement, with famous artists such as Picasso, Van Gogh, and Renoir calling it home. The iconic Le Moulin Rouge, with its extravagant cabaret shows, became a symbol of the neighborhood’s bohemian spirit.

Today, Montmartre continues to thrive as an artistic haven, with its charming cafes, art studios, and galleries that showcase the talents of both established and emerging artists. Must-See Attractions in Montmartre

With its rich artistic heritage and vibrant atmosphere, Montmartre offers a stack of must-see attractions that capture the essence of this iconic Parisian neighborhood. Explore the following attractions to truly learn about the charm and history of Montmartre:

  • La Moulin Rouge: Step into the world of cabaret and glamour at one of the most famous landmarks in Montmartre. Admire the iconic red windmill and indulge in an unforgettable evening of entertainment.

  • Sacré-Coeur Basilica: Marvel at the stunning white-domed basilica that sits atop the highest point in Montmartre. Take in panoramic views of the city from its steps and explore the intricate interior adorned with beautiful mosaics.

  • Place du Tertre: Wander through the lively square that was once a gathering place for artists and intellectuals. Today, it is filled with charming cafes, street artists, and art galleries, offering a glimpse into Montmartre’s artistic past.

  • Le Bateau-Lavoir: Visit the former bohemian outpost where artists such as Picasso and Modigliani once lived and worked. This historic building played a significant role in the development of modern art.

  • Montmartre Vineyard: Discover a hidden gem in the heart of Montmartre – a vineyard dating back to the 12th century. Take a stroll through the vineyard, learn about its fascinating history, and enjoy a glass of wine in this peaceful oasis.

These attractions embody the spirit of Montmartre, offering a captivating blend of art, history, and culture that cannot be missed.
